Web1 okt. 2024 · White spot is caused when a protozoan attacks and attaches itself to a fish’s body, fins, and gills. The white spots that appear look like grains of salt or sugar, but each one is actually a tiny parasite. Can white spot disease kill a fish? If left untreated, it WILL have fatal effects. Web26 jun. 2024 · A common issue that fish owners face is the growth of white stuff on their fish. This white stuff is often referred to as “white spot disease” and is caused by a parasitic protozoan called Ichthyophthirius multifiliis.
